LaVine Woller

August 21, 1926 — July 2, 2023

Merrill

LaVine Valera Woller, age 96, of Merrill, Wisconsin peacefully passed away on Sunday, July 2, 2023 at Bell Tower Residence Assisted Living in Merrill, Wisconsin. She was born on August 21, 1926 to the late William and Hertha (Sturm) Neumann in the Town of Berlin, Wisconsin.

LaVine married her first husband, Charles Bartelt, on June 6, 1946, he preceded her in death on May 5, 1977. She married her second husband, Raymond Ohrmundt, on November 2, 1979, he preceded her in death on February 29, 1984. On July 12, 1987, LaVine married Leonard Woller, he preceded her in death on June 12, 2017.

LaVine used to farm with her first husband, Charles, and went along on the “pig route” as a pig hauler with him for 15 years. She was a homemaker and an excellent seamstress, who put her talents towards working at her sister-in-law’s bridal salon.  LaVine was always well dressed, ensuring her outfits and jewelry would match and her nails and hair were always done. She loved gardening, going on trips, polka dancing, and feeding the birds. She was a fantastic cook and was an excellent shot with the gun, when it came to unwanted critters. She also enjoyed spending time with her family.
